Ziplining is, of course, the biggest draw at Flight of the Gibbon Chiang Mai. While the activity is a fantastic adrenaline-pumping adventure in itself, ziplining through the lush green rainforests of Thailand takes the experience up by a notch. The adventure park features 15 separate ziplining courses at varying lengths, with the longest one spanning up to 800 meters. Visitors will be free to choose from a suitable course as per their adventure appetite and level of expertise. Sailing through, one can catch a sight of the friendly resident gibbons that the Flight of the Gibbons owes its name to.
Rappelling is another one of the mini-adventures that make up the obstacle courses at Flight of Gibbon Chiang Mai. Rappelling, also known as abseiling or mountain climbing, is a sport where climbers must descend down near vertical heights while harnessed to a rope around their waists. Rappelling sports tests one’s stamina as well as strength. At Flight of the Gibbon, adventurers must abseil down trees to the forest floor. The abseils however, form a minor part of the adventure courses at the park, as opposed to the ziplines.
Location: Between Mae Takhrai National park and Chae Son National Park in the forest Village of Mae Kampong.
Timing: The Flight of the Gibbon experience includes pickup from one’s hotel in Chiang Mai. The pick up timings are as follows:- 6.30am- 8am- 9am- 12.30pm
How to Reach: Tourists will be picked up from their hotels in Chiang Mai and taken to the adventure course in air conditioned vans. The drive is an hour away from Chiang Mai city center.

What are the safety precautions being used in Flight Of The Gibbon Chiang Mai?
Flight of the Gibbon's purpose is to present you with exciting activities and lasting memories. The Zipline courses were designed with safety in mind by industry-leading international specialists with decades of expertise in the sector.
At each of the Zipline course locations, Flight of the Gibbon employs a full-time staff of international safety and maintenance specialists. Courses and equipment are inspected regularly, and any worn or damaged components are replaced as soon as possible. Every month, a detailed assessment is done, and complete maintenance logs are kept on-site at each facility.
The adventure course employs Petzl and ISC equipment from France and England, both of which meet or exceed European safety standards. They are also the first zipline firm in Thailand and Southeast Asia to put the 'Zippy Anti-Roll Back Cam' to the test, which prevents zipliners from rolling back on the zipline wire.
Is there any guide available for Ziplining in Chiang Mai?
When you zipline with Flight of the Gibbon, party numbers are kept small to protect your safety and make your experience even more pleasurable. Your group will consist of a maximum of nine members, with two fully trained Sky Rangers allocated to each group. The Sky Rangers will give you a detailed safety briefing before individually outfitting you with the necessary safety gear. The Sky Rangers will explain all you need to know to enjoy the finest Zipline experience possible.
